title = "NovoFEL as Source of Powerful Ultramonochromatic Tunable Terahertz Radiation",
abstract = "Laser nature of a continuous pulse-periodical radiation of the Novosibirsk free-electron laser (NovoFEL) appears in a good coherency of its pulses and very narrow synchronized longitudinal modes. Filtration of one of the modes by a system of three resonance Fabry-Perot interferometers allows to create laser source with monochromaticity which is sufficient for typical high-resolution THz spectroscopy (delta f/f",
